SPCC Declares Dividend

Business Wire, Feb 28, 2001

Business Editors

MEXICO CITY, D.F.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Feb. 28, 2001

Southern Peru Copper Corporation (SPCC) (NYSE:PCU and LSE:PCUC1) announced today a quarterly dividend of 14.3 cents per share payable April 4, 2001 to shareholders of record at the close of business on March 16, 2001.

SPCC is one of Peru's largest companies and one of the ten largest copper producers worldwide. The ownership of SPCC shares, either directly or through subsidiaries, is as follows: Grupo Mexico (54.2%); Cerro Trading Company (14.2%); Phelps Dodge (14.0%), and other shareholders (17.6%).

Grupo Mexico is a diversified mining company that ranks as the world's third largest copper producer, fourth largest silver producer and fifth largest zinc producer. The Company's mining operations include mining, smelting and refining in Mexico, the United States and in Peru. The Company has also developed one of the largest copper ore reserve positions in the industry. In addition, Grupo Mexico owns a majority of the largest and most profitable railroad in Mexico.
